Job Title: Route Process Administrator - Part time
Job Objective
Performs pre-settlement and/or cashiering duties in a Sales Center in accordance with standard procedures.

Job Responsibility
• Driver Over and Short research and resolution (cash and product/load)
• Review and verify end of day driver paperwork
• Run daily route status report to verify that all delivery routes settled
• Send messages to route accounting department regarding settlement issues
• Ensure proof of deliveries are included in driver paperwork (DSD, store stamps, etc.)
• Perform cashiering duties including ensuring Fed-Ready status of deposit
• Ensure security of route cash
• Validate proper use of cash drop log
• Receive and verify full service bag count.
• Count full service cash and finalize handheld
• Prepare driver paperwork for Imaging
• Maintain driver compliance logs as necessary (DOT, DVR, etc)
• Maintain cash reconciliation and driver deposit log
• Maintain records in BASIS route accounting system
• Review settlement exception reports and resolve issues
• Prepare deposit for pick up by armored car service
• Troubleshoot handheld issues impacting settlement
• Work with warehouse inventory personnel to resolve SAP (inventory system) to BASIS (sales accounting system) reconciling items

Job Requirements
• High School - GED or Diploma required.
• Some college preferred.
• 2-5 years experience in automated office environment required.
• Experience using BASIS route accounting system preferred.
• Experience in cash room environment preferred.

Job Title: Driver - Merchandiser
Job Objective
Coca-Cola Enterprises has a variety of driving positions requiring a commercial driver's license. The far majority of our Coca-Cola trucks require a Class A CDL. We do hire a limited number of Class B CDL Drivers each year.
Our CDL Drivers are responsible for driving and delivery of pre-ordered product to assigned accounts and for rotating and stocking product according to our merchandising standards.

Job Responsibility
Check accuracy and stability of the load.
Deliver products to customers.
Merchandise, display and rotate products according to company standards.
Invoice and collect monies due.
Pick up company property.
Secure company assets.
Ensure compliance with regulatory and company policies and procedures.
Settle all accounts daily.

Job Requirements
High School diploma or GED preferred.
1-3 years of general work experience required.
1+ years of commercial driving experience preferred.
Local delivery experience preferred.
Prior grocery store and/or consumer products experience a plus.
Ability to operate a two or four wheel dolly.
Familiarity with Department of Transportation (DOT) regulations.
Ability to work with minimal supervision.
Valid Class A or B Driver's License required.
Driving record within MVR policy guidelines preferred.
Background checks and drug testing conducted on all new hires.

Job Title: Account Manager
Job Objective
Responsible for selling and ordering products at customer locations.  
 
Job Responsibilities
Execute and close all sales calls.
Sell in incremental displays and equipment placements; sell in promotional programs and ensure dealer compliance.
In connection with a sales call, maintain appropriate inventory levels, maintain company assets and point of sale, ensure account meets Company merchandising standards, determine stores' product needs, place and transmit appropriate order in conjunction with existing geographic sales routes.
Communicate account activities to appropriate parties
Transport, replace and maintain Point of Sale advertising as appropriate for account.
Periodic lifting of 50+ pounds, bending, reaching, kneeling.
 
Job Requirements
High School or GED (General Education Diploma) required.
Bachelor Degree/3-4 Yr College - Univ. Degree preferred.
1+ years of general work experience.
1+ years previous sales experience preferred.
Food/beverage industry experience a plus.
Ability to handle multiple customer accounts.
Strong attention to detail and follow-up skills.
Excellent planning and organization skills.
Proficient computer application skills.
Ability to create and conduct sales presentations preferred.
Valid driver's license and driving record within MVR policy guidelines.
